"Bosch" Renewed for 7th & Final Season at Amazon
by Denise Petski February 13, 2020 "Bosch" is getting an early renewal and an end date. Amazon has picked up a seventh and final season of its hit drama series starring Titus Welliver and based on Michael Connelly’s bestselling books. The renewal comes ahead of Bosch’s sixth-season premiere later in 2020 on Amazon Prime Video. “I’m proud of what we have accomplished with Bosch and look forward to completing the story in Season 7. It’s bittersweet, but all good things come to an end, and I am happy that we will be able to go out the way we want to,” said Connelly. https://deadline.com/2020/02/bosch-r...on-1202859488/ |

"Bosch" Spin-off Picked Up at IMDb TV; Titus Welliver, Mimi Rogers & Madison Lintz to Reprise Roles
by Peter White March 3, 2021 The "Bosch" universe is expanding. IMDb TV has picked up a spin-off of the long-running Amazon crime drama, with stars Titus Welliver, Mimi Rogers and Madison Lintz reprising their roles from the original series. This comes as the seventh and final season of the show launches this summer on Amazon. The untitled spin-off will follow Harry Bosch, played by Welliver, as he embarks on the next chapter of his career and finds himself working with his one-time enemy and top-notch attorney Honey “Money” Chandler, played by Rogers. With a deep and complicated history between this unlikely pair, they must work together to do what they can agree on – finding justice. “To say I am ecstatic is an understatement. To be given the opportunity to tell more Harry Bosch stories is a tremendous gift,” said Titus Welliver. “The process of shooting season seven with the shadow of it being our final loomed heavily so when the idea was presented to continue with the possibility of a spinoff, without hesitation I said, ‘let’s go.’ To all of our Bosch fans, thank for your incredible support for all these years and I can promise you the ride will only get better.” https://deadline.com/2021/03/bosch-s...tz-1234705787/ |

"Bosch" Franchise Expanding with 2 New Crime Dramas in Development
by Matt Webb Mitovich February 7, 2023 Stand back, new DCU. The "Bosch" Universe is possibly expanding further. Amazon Studios has announced that it is developing two new shows inspired by the work of best-selling author Michael Connelly, whose Harry Bosch novels of course already gave us "Bosch" (which ran seven seasons on Prime Video) and then "Bosch: Legacy" (currently between Seasons 1 and 2 on Freevee). One of the series in development would be a police drama following Harry Bosch’s former partner, Detective Jerry Edgar, after he gets tapped for an undercover FBI mission in Little Haiti, Miami. “In this glamorous city, J. Edgar is forced to balance his new life with the gritty underbelly of the city, while being chased by his mysterious past,” says the synopsis. The other Bosch-iverse series in the works would follow Detective Renee Ballard, a character from Connelly’s novels who is tasked with running the LAPD’s new cold case division. Beyond simply investigating unsolved crimes, Renee is dedicated to bringing credibility to the department and justice to the community. Having learned from her retired ally and mentor, Harry Bosch, Renee does things her way – solving cases in unconventional ways while navigating the politics of being a woman on the rise in the LAPD. https://tvline.com/2023/02/07/bosch-...e-jerry-edgar/ |

Second "Bosch" Spin-off, About Detective Renée Ballard, Ordered at Prime Video
by Andy Swift November 17, 2023 Prime Video has given a formal order to an untitled spin-off series focused on LAPD detective Renée Ballard, a major character in Michael Connelly’s Harry Bosch novels, TVLine has learned. Per the official announcement, the series will follow Detective Ballard, “who is tasked with running the LAPD’s new cold case division — a poorly funded, all-volunteer unit with the largest case load in the city. Ballard approaches these frozen-in-time cases with empathy and determination. When she uncovers a larger conspiracy during her investigations, she’ll lean on the assistance of her retired ally, Harry Bosch, to navigate the dangers that threaten both her unit and her life.” “From books to screen, Michael Connelly creates authentic and suspenseful stories, led by distinctive characters who make audiences care and connect,” Lauren Anderson, head of AVOD originals, unscripted, and targeted programming at Amazon MGM Studios, says in a statement. “Renée Ballard is one of those characters. She instantly captivated readers with hints of a troubled past and a protective layer of idiosyncrasies she developed to survive. We look forward to expanding the Bosch universe with Michael and introducing viewers to Ballard’s personal approach to pursuing justice.” Adds Connelly, “It is so exciting to bring Renée Ballard to the screen and to do it with Prime Video, my streaming partners for going on 10 years. This show will have the same authenticity and propulsive momentum of Bosch: Legacy. Fans of the books will love it.” https://tvline.com/news/bosch-spinof...eo-1235082484/ |
